In that spirit, if you need them, here are some ideas. This isn’t the perfect list – so feel free to add your ideas to the comments:
1. Digital – Shift event expenses (if you can get them back) to digital programs that are meaningful. If your budget has been reduced, think about lowering your brand ad spending and focusing on CTA related ads. With any digital – evaluate if your message is right now. How can your business help to take into account the current environment?
2. Email – this is a great tactic – just make sure your tone is helpful and consultative. It’s important to ask, ‘How can I help?’ versus ‘Sign up for a demo.’
3. Webinars / virtual events – try virtual events and webinars instead of physical events. You’re going to need to keep in mind, a lot of people are going to do this – so think about what’s going to make your event stand out.
4. Content – People may be given more time to consume content. Can your team create more content in the form of blogs, videos, or eBooks? How can you engage your customer base online for companies that have had to close store fronts? It could be time to create a story or newsletter that is sent out weekly.
5. Partners – Get close to partners – how can teams come together to make a bigger impact with less? Would you like to develop a webinar series, training, videos?
6. Social – Is there a way you can make more use of social media in your business? Can someone help keep a conversation going with your brand while times are a bit uncertain?
7. Customers – Double down on the customer. They are the most important and most valuable part of your business. Ask them what they need, and how you can help them. Offer free training – maybe some of your SC’s are traveling less – that’s good for your customers.
8. Verticals – is there an industry that shines through where you could double – or could you benefit from your help?
9. Team Development – Can people on your team take advantage of this as an opportunity to learn new skills? I’m getting my event team to pick up the webinars and help the SDR team.
10. Take a breath and try to be positive with your teams. People deal with stress in different ways, be sensitive to it.
